Adam Simpson signs with FOX Footy
Former West Coast Eagles Premiership coach signs on for the 2025 AFL season.

FOX Footy has signed former West Coast Eagles Premiership coach Adam Simpson as an analyst for the 2025 AFL season.
Simpson – who played 306 games for North Melbourne and coached 242 games for West Coast – announced the news live on FOX Cricket, during Day 1 of the Australia v India Perth Test.
“It feels like I have been drafted again. I’m really excited to join the team and look forward to getting started with FOX Footy,” he said.
He follows recent recruits Shaun Burgoyne, Tom Hawkins, Leigh Matthews.
